Burglary suspects flee after crash at Kensington and PoplarEl Cerrito CA

audio iconBurglary
Kensington Rd, El Cerrito, CA

Police responded to a burglary where a stolen vehicle crashed at Kensington and Poplar. Two juvenile suspects ran away and officers set up a search perimeter with help from other agencies.
